Spectrum Health Systems Appoints Three New Regional Executive Directors

Published On: December 11th, 2020

Spectrum Health Systems, Inc., a longtime not-for-profit organization dedicated to providing a comprehensive continuum of addiction treatment throughout Massachusetts, today announces the promotion of three valued employees to leadership roles. The strategic appointments of Christina Rossi, Rebecca Polastri, and Heidi DiRoberto to Regional Executive Directors will ensure that outpatient operations continue to run smoothly as the organization significantly grows and expands its programs over the next year.

“We have expanded our geographical footprint significantly in recent years and knew that we needed to strategically grow our leadership team to match,” said Kurt Isaacson, Spectrum Health Systems’ CEO. “With more locations and clients across the Commonwealth, it was increasingly important to institute a strong regional strategy. Christina, Rebecca and Heidi are well-equipped to lead their respective regions and we greatly look forward to the important work they will do for their communities in their new roles.”

Rossi, Polastri, and DiRoberto have a collective 23 years of experience in working with Spectrum. They have all run opiate treatment programs (OTPs) at various Massachusetts locations, and each have been integral in helping to grow those programs. Their previous time spent serving as Program Directors for multiple individual clinics has provided them with the expertise they will need in their new executive positions.

“Christina, Rebecca and Heidi have been incredible assets to our outpatient programs for years,” said Kristin Nolan, Senior Vice President of Behavioral Health at Spectrum Health Systems. “We are thrilled to see them taking on even more responsibility as Regional Executive Directors. Under their leadership we have opened new programs and grown admissions numbers, and they remain committed to improving our treatment offerings at all our locations. We can’t wait to see how they bring their gifts and expertise to their new roles.”

Rossi will now be overseeing Spectrum’s outpatient programs in Framingham, Waltham, Haverhill, Saugus and Weymouth. She began her career with Spectrum as a clinician in 2011. In 2014, she assisted in the opening of the Haverhill OTP and served as its Program Director. Under her leadership, the program grew rapidly and currently treats over 450 clients. In 2016, she opened another OTP center in Saugus. Rossi’s experience in opening and operating multiple clinics has prepared her for her new position as Regional Executive Director, where she will continue to oversee existing programs while supporting our ongoing growth across the state of Massachusetts.

Polastri successfully aided in the launch of Spectrum’s OTP in Pittsfield in 2012 which has continued to grow, now serving more than 600 clients each day. She assisted with the opening of the North Adams program in 2015, where she served as its Program Director. Lastly, Polastri was instrumental in opening Spectrum’s newest center in Great Barrington earlier this year. In her new role as Regional Executive Director, Polastri will oversee all operations in Pittsfield, North Adams, Great Barrington, Southridge, and Leominster.

DiRoberto, who has been working with Spectrum since 2014, will oversee the OTP programs in Worcester as well as the Hub & Spoke program in Worcester, and the OTP programs in Millbury and Milford as the latest Regional Executive Director. She brings six years of experience in supervising OTPs from her time at the Lincoln Street facility in Worcester. As its former Clinical Supervisor and Program Director, she developed the Trauma Informed Care Program, a grief and loss curriculum for use across the inpatient and outpatient systems. DiRoberto also chaired an overdose committee and helped implement a new system for providing all outpatient clients with access to the lifesaving naloxone nasal spray and injectable.

About Spectrum Health Systems
Based in Worcester, Mass. and founded in 1969, Spectrum Health Systems, Inc. is a private, nonprofit substance use and mental health treatment provider. Spectrum offers the largest and most complete continuum of addiction treatment in New England — including inpatient detoxification, residential rehabilitation, outpatient services, medication-assisted treatment and peer recovery support. Its subsidiary, The New England Recovery Center provides onsite detoxification and inpatient addiction treatment exclusively for commercially insured and private pay clients.
